The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self—hardwood or luxury vinyl—will shift the total significantly. You also have to consider the square footage of the space and the current condition of your subfloor. Tack on factors like stairs, furniture moving, and the complexity of the layout, and you have your total.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

For excellent value in Oxnard, luxury vinyl plank is a top choice due to its durability and resistance to moisture, which is beneficial near the coast. It offers a wide range of attractive styles at a reasonable price. A local pro can discuss its long-term benefits and cost-effectiveness.
Vinyl plank is generally recommended for Oxnard homes due to its superior resistance to moisture and humidity, common near the California coast. Laminate can be a good option for drier areas, but vinyl offers more peace of mind. A specialist can help you choose based on your specific rooms.
